Ticket: SDK parity gap caused by staging misconfiguration

The Norvell Swift SDK passes the parity suite, but the Kotlin SDK fails the token-refresh cases on staging. Root cause: staging's env file was copied from the demo tier and lacks the refresh credential. To unblock the 4.2 release, open `staging.env`, keep `NORVELL_REFRESH_ENABLED=true`, and on the line directly after it set the refresh signing secret.

sealed setting: LEDGER_TOKEN29=130a4f7ada97c8be1e00128e577ab

## Fan-out Backpressure (Pulsewick Notifier)

When the Pulsewick notifier falls behind, the fan-out queue accumulates undelivered events and downstream channels (push, digest, in-app) begin timing out. Do not restart the workers first; that discards in-flight batches. Instead, confirm the backpressure gauge on the Harbordeck dashboard is above the amber threshold, then throttle intake by lowering the accept rate. The current production settings that govern throttling and retry pacing are listed below.

settings of tagef-bawif:
DRUIX_HOST=druix.zemvarlabs.internal
DRUIX_PORT=8000

**Handover: Encoding detection — Quillbox uploads**

Uploads hit the sniffer first; it checks BOMs, then runs the Bramblewood heuristic over the first 64KB. Ambiguous results fall back to Latin-1, which causes most of the mojibake tickets. Confidence scores are logged per file. The decision table, known edge cases, and override flags are documented on the internal page here.

runbook for badug-kadup: https://confluence.zemvarlabs.internal/projects/browse/display/projects/bd1b

# TideSpan Widget — Limits & Quotas

Plugin authors embedding the TideSpan tide-table widget must respect per-origin quotas. Requests above the ceiling return a throttle response; repeated violations suspend the plugin key for one hour. Quotas reset at midnight Harbright time. Cached tide predictions are valid for six hours, so poll sparingly. Batch endpoints count each station as one request. The enforced limits are defined by these constants.

tuning table, fawig-yagef:
RATE_LIMITS = {
    "quenix": 10,
    "holael": 10,
    "holath": 2,
    "ralix": 1,
}